    They are legit. Check out the investor requirements to see if you qualify to invest. I’ve heard sharespost is better, but I haven’t used them myself.

    Read up on how it all technically works. TL;DR An LLC will own your shares until they’re public. Also you’ll pay a 3-5% fee on top of a 10k minimum.

    FWIW, Carta’s building a cool private secondary market, but I don’t know the ETA on that yet.
